Common Japanese Words & Phrases

873 everyday words with readings, romaji, and native audio

お風呂に入るおふろにはいる Ofuronihairu to take a bath
掃除するそうじする Souji suru to clean (something)
洗うあらう Arau to wash (no direct object)
洗濯するせんたくする Sentakusuru to do laundry
1. 切る 2. 着る1.きる2.きる Kiru 1. to cut 2. to put on clothes (above the waist)
履くはく Haku to put on clothes (below the waist)
眼鏡をかけるめがねをかける Megane wo Kakeru to put on glasses
消すけす Kesu to turn off, switch off, erase
教えるおしえる Oshieru to teach, tell
習うならう Narau to learn
思うおもう Omou to think, believe — believe in the sense of personal opinion rather than a strong belief
始めるはじめる Hajimeru to begin (direct object)
終るおわる Owaru to end
早くなるはやくなる Hayakunaru to be early, to arrive early, to come early
遅くなるおそくなる Osokunaru to be late/ to arrive late/ to come late
読むよむ Yomu to read
書くかく Kaku to write
知るしる Shiru to know, to get to know someone
忘れるわすれる Wasureru to forget, leave behind
数えるかぞえる Kazoeru to count (numbers, things, etc)
勉強するべんきょうする Benkyou suru to study
休むやすむ Yasumu to rest, take a day off
さぼる Saboru to skip (school / work)
あげる Ageru to give, offer (from speaker to someone else)
貰うもらう Morau to receive, get (direct object to speaker)
持って行くもっていく Motteiku to take (an inanimate object away from speaker’s location)
連れてくるつれてくる Tsuretekuru to bring (a person or being)
買うかう Kau to buy
売るうる Uru to sell
働くはたらく Hataraku to work
勤めるつとめる Tsutomeru to work (for someone or something)
借りるかりる Kariru to borrow, rent
貸すかす Kasu to lend, loan
返すかえす Kaesu to return (an item) , repay
住むすむ Sumu to live, to reside, to inhabit
開けるあける Akeru to open (direct object を) Ex. Mouths, eyes, doors, etc
閉めるしめる Shimeru to shut, close (requires a direct object ex. doors, windows, etc.)
タバコを吸うタバコをすう Tabako wo suu to smoke a cigarette
酔うよう You to be drunk, get drunk, feel dizzy
運転するうんてんする Untensuru to drive
かかる Kakaru to take (amount of time/ money) eg. It takes me 2 hours OR It took 4000 yen
紹介するしょうかいする Shoukaisuru to introduce, present
待つまつ Matsu to wait
急ぐいそぐ Isogu to hurry
会うあう Au to meet
払うはらう Harau to pay
座るすわる Suwaru to sit
立つたつ Tatsu to stand, rise
喧嘩するけんかする Kenkasuru to fight (physical) , to argue/quarrel (verbal)
手伝うてつだう Tetsudau to help (eg. lending a hand. Tasukeru is helping when someone is in crisis/danger)
決めるきめる Kimeru to decide
間違うまちがう Machigau to be mistaken, be wrong (no direct object)
電話をかけるでんわをかける Denwa wo kakeru to make a phone call
作るつくる Tsukuru to make, create
使うつかう Tsukau to use
笑うわらう Warau to laugh, smile
泣くなく Naku to cry
落とすおとす Otosu to drop
じろじろ見るじろじろみる Jirojiromiru to stare
踊るおどる Odoru to dance
